Amjad Masad is a Jordanian-American entrepreneur and software engineer, best known as the founder and CEO of Replit, an innovative platform designed to make coding more accessible and collaborative. His journey from a young coder in Jordan to leading a billion-dollar tech company is both inspiring and transformative for the software development landscape.
Amjad Masad’s professional journey includes pivotal roles at major tech companies. He was a founding engineer at Codecademy, where he helped build an online platform offering free coding classes. He then worked at Facebook from 2013 to 2016 as a software engineer, overseeing the JavaScript infrastructure team and developing open-source developer tools. In 2016, Masad co-founded Replit with Haya Odeh and Faris Masad. Initially, Replit began as a browser-based integrated development environment (IDE) that allowed users to write and deploy code without complex setups, and it has since evolved into an AI-powered software creation ecosystem, enabling users to build applications through natural language descriptions.
Masad envisions a world where software creation is as ubiquitous as literacy. Under his leadership, Replit has grown to over 30 million users, secured $200 million in venture funding, and achieved a valuation of $1.2 billion. The platform’s Agent technology, launched in 2024, allows users to generate applications from natural language descriptions, marking a significant step toward making coding more accessible.
Early Life and Education
Amjad Masad was born in Amman, Jordan, to immigrant parents. His father’s family is Palestinian, and his mother’s family is Algerian. Growing up, Masad faced financial hardships, but his family placed a strong emphasis on education, which played a pivotal role in shaping his future endeavors.
He attended Mashrek International School in Amman, where he completed his IGCSE studies in subjects like Math, Physics, Computing, Economics, English, Arabic, and Biology. This diverse academic background laid the foundation for his future in technology.
Masad pursued higher education at Princess Sumaya University for Technology in Jordan, earning a Bachelor of Science degree in Computer Science between 2005 and 2010. During his time at university, he excelled in programming competitions, securing first place in the local programming contest and participating in the ACM ICPC and IEEE Extreme programming competitions. He also contributed to securing the university’s online registration system, showcasing his practical skills early on.
Career Path
Early Career and Foundational Experiences
Amjad Masad’s professional journey began in Jordan, where he honed his skills in web development and IT. His early roles included positions at companies such as Arcadia Software Development and Boss Consulting SA, where he worked as a web developer and security specialist. These experiences laid the groundwork for his future endeavors in the tech industry.
Founding Engineer at Codecademy (2011–2013)
In 2011, Masad joined Codecademy as a founding engineer. Codecademy was an innovative platform that offered interactive coding lessons to users, aiming to make programming more accessible. During his tenure, Masad contributed to the development of the platform, helping to shape its early success and reach a broad audience of learners.
Software Engineer at Facebook (2013–2016)
Following his time at Codecademy, Masad moved to Silicon Valley to work at Facebook. From 2013 to 2016, he served as a software engineer, overseeing the JavaScript infrastructure team. In this role, he was instrumental in developing some of Facebook’s most popular open-source developer tools. His work at Facebook provided him with invaluable experience in building scalable systems and tools used by millions of developers worldwide.
Founding Replit (2016–Present)
In 2016, Masad co-founded Replit, a platform designed to make coding more accessible and collaborative. Replit started as a browser-based integrated development environment (IDE) that allowed users to write and deploy code without complex setups. Over time, the platform evolved into an AI-powered software creation ecosystem, enabling users to build applications through natural language descriptions.
Under Masad’s leadership, Replit has grown significantly. As of 2025, the platform boasts over 30 million users and has secured \$200 million in venture funding, achieving a valuation of \$1.2 billion. Replit’s innovations, such as the introduction of Ghostwriter, an AI coding assistant, and the Agent platform, which allows users to generate applications from natural language prompts, have positioned the company at the forefront of the AI-driven software development revolution.

Personal Life
Amjad Masad is married to Haya Odeh, one of the co-founders of Replit. Together, they have built a company that reflects their shared vision of making coding accessible to all. While Masad maintains a relatively private personal life, he has expressed his commitment to creating a work environment that values diversity and inclusion.
In his personal time, Masad enjoys activities like powerlifting, grilling steaks, and reading science fiction classics such as “The Forbidden Planet,” “Brazil,” and “Colossus: The Forbin Project.” These interests reflect his curiosity and appreciation for both technology and storytelling .
